Another set <strong>of</strong>liptinite-rich samples has been selected for spectral fluorescence measurements<br />
on sporinite and alginite macerals. Spectral fluorescence behaviours o[ sporinite<br />
and alginite in these Tertiary coals and in coals [rom an Upper Permian seam reveal that<br />
Lambda max. and spectral Quotients (Q) <strong>of</strong> sporinite have relation wi[b age, whereas [bose<br />
<strong>of</strong> alginite with rank. The plotting <strong>of</strong> Clu'omaticity Coefficients, calculated from the corresponding<br />
fluorescence colours, on Chromaticity Diagram <strong>of</strong> International Colourimetry<br />
System (DIN 6164 D 65.2") has been found helpful in differentiating sporinite types and<br />
fluorescence colour.<br />

RECONSTRUCTION OF QUATERNARY VEGETATIONAL PATTERNS<br />
History <strong>of</strong> vegetation and climate in tropical montane<br />
forests in south India<br />
Objective To build up a complete palyn<strong>of</strong>loral succession <strong>of</strong> the Shola<br />
forest/grassland in Annamalai Hills, Palni Hills and Silent Valley<br />
Twenty soil samples from Berijam Lake pr<strong>of</strong>ile, Palni Hills, dating back to 20,000<br />
yrs B.P. have been pollen analysed and one pollen diagram prepared. Three vegetational<br />
stages have been phased out in order to record all possible events and episodes which [be<br />
vegetation has witnessed in time and space.<br />
